The Phoenix look to keep their winning streak alive as they head to the Apple Isle to take on the JackJumpers for Thursday night hoops.
Key Details
TASMANIA JACKJUMPERS (5-5) 5th v. SOUTH EAST MELBOURNE PHOENIX (6-2) 2nd
Where: Silverdome, Tasmania
When: Thursday, November 11 at 7:30pm AEDT
Watch: ESPN
The Phoenix are coming off a five-point win over the Wildcats on Sunday afternoon as they head into Thursday’s clash with the JackJumpers.
The last time the two sides met was in NBL25, when the Phoenix set a franchise record with 116 points, but both teams have a new look heading into this matchup.
It will also mark the first time the Phoenix face former teammate Ben Ayre, now a JackJumper, who will be eager to make an impact against his old side.
Scott Roth’s team are coming off an upset loss to the Cairns Taipans by six points on Saturday, extending their losing streak at the Silverdome.
TEAMS
Phoenix
Angus Glover will miss round 8 due to an ankle injury sustained last round, an estimated timeframe for his return will be determined in the next few days. Development player Pat Ryan will replace him in the side.
JackJumpers
Anthony Drmic (back complaint) will miss the game on Thursday.
KEEP AN EYE ON
The brick walls: John Brown III & Malique Lewis
The defensive duo of John Brown III and Next Star Malique Lewis have become synonymous with the Phoenix’s defensive identity. Brown III currently ranks third in the league for steals, while Lewis sits seventh, helping the Phoenix lead the NBL in steals with 10.4 per game.
